Understanding Information Brokers and Their Impact


Data brokers are organizations that accumulate personal data from various sources, frequently without individuals' approval. They create and organize this information to create detailed profiles, which they then offer to companies, and even individuals. These records can feature everything from purchasing patterns to social media activity, making personal data incredibly profitable in the internet marketplace. As a consequence, consumers become unaware victims in a system where their private information is exchanged like a commodity.


The impact of data brokers on privacy is significant. Many individuals realize their data distributed and shared across various mediums, typically leading to invasive requests and targeted marketing. Guidelines to Eliminate Your Data on the Internet


To begin the procedure of removing your data online, the first action is to determine the data vendors that have your personal data. Firms like Truth Finder, Spokeo, and White Pages are recognized to gather and distribute this data. Commence by scouring for your name on these sites to see what data is accessible. This will offer you a clear understanding of where your data is stored and how it is being used.


As soon as you have a compilation of data brokers, you can move forward to opt-out of these platforms. Most legitimate data brokers offer a way for you to demand the extraction of your information. You will typically need to provide proof of identity and adhere to specific guidelines on their sites. It is a recommended action to keep track of your submissions and confirmations, as some brokers may not complete the procedure quickly.

Legal Measures and Data Confidentiality Legislation


As the fight against data brokers escalates, various court actions and legislative measures are being proposed to improve information privacy for individuals. Notably, the aftermath of notable information breaches, such as those affecting copyright and copyright, has heightened the urgency for customer protection. These incidents have subjected millions of people to identity theft and confidentiality violations, prompting legislators to consider more strong regulations that make companies responsible for data security. Current suggestions aim to create stricter standards for information handling and transparency, providing consumers with the ability to know how their personal information is used and to who it is sold.


In addition to legislative initiatives, several regions have enacted laws allowing individuals the option to opt-out of information broker transactions and to request the deletion of their data. The California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A) has set a standard, enabling inhabitants to gain control of their personal data. These legislative structures are a response to growing awareness about the widespread systems of businesses selling private information. As consumers demand more control, more states are likely to join in, possibly leading to a nationwide standard for data confidentiality.
